About GP Investments
GP Investments is a pioneer of Brazilian private equity making active-ownership buyout and growth investments since 1993. The firm emphasizes permanent capital and technology transformation.
Key features
- Active-ownership buyout strategy
- $5B+ deployed since 1993
- Investments incl. Fogo de Chão, 99 Taxis, Estácio
- Listed on B3 (Brazil stock exchange)
- Offices in São Paulo, New York, Zurich
